#20ba24 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#20ba24 is composed of 12.5% red, 72.9%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.6%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 121.6 degrees, a saturation of 70.6% and a lightness of 42.7%. #20ba24 color hex could be obtained by blending #40ff48 with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#20ba24 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#20ba24 has RGB values of R:32, G:186,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.81,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 2144804.

Shades and Tints of #20ba24
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000200 is the darkest color, while #f0fcf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#20ba24
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6f6c is the less saturated color, while #07d30c is the most saturated one.
